2 ultras killed in encounter in Jammu
Tuesday, January 13, 2009 18:26 [IST]

Jammu: Two policemen laid down their lives while battling with a group of militants in an encounter that left two of the ultras killed at Rajouri district of Jammu and Kahsmir today.

On information that five militants were hiding in Tringa Gala area of Dharamshal belt in Rajouri, a police team launched a cordon and search operation, Noushera Superintendent of Police R K Bhat told PTI.

A gunbattle followed and two militants were killed. Two policemen also fell to the bullets of ultras.

The encounter is continuing with the holed up ultras. Details are awaited.
